What is the next fraction in the geometric sequence 3/4 1/2 1/3 2/9

Respuesta :

JaySL JaySL
  • 12-08-2015
1/2 is equal to 2/3*3/4, so each fraction is 2/3 of the last.  The next fraction will thus be 2/3*2/9=4/27.
